Common Questions About Attic Water Removal
What causes water damage in the attic?
Water damage in the attic can be caused by various factors, including roof leaks, condensation, clogged gutters, and storm damage.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ent these issues.

How can I prevent water damage in the attic?
Regular maintenance, inspections, and repairs can help prevent water damage in the attic. Keep gutters clean, inspect roof leaks, and ensure proper ventilation to prevent moisture buildup.
